during our lifetime, the colour producing cells in hair roots (melanocytes) are damaged due to various factors resulting greying of hair. Factors like dietary deficiency, oxidative stress, smoking, thyroid issues and using chemical hair products result in premature greying but genetics plays a bigger role.
There isnât any scientifically proven medicine or serum to stop premature greying but certain things can prevent or delay the premature greying. Antioxidants rich...more

Biotin is a b vitamin that is essential for healthy hair growth. However, there is limited scientific evidence to suggest that biotin supplements can help slow down receding hairlines. While some people have reported seeing an improvement in their hair growth and thickness after taking biotin supplements, more research is needed to determine the effectiveness of biotin for hair loss. Additionally, it's important to note that receding hairlines can have many different causes, and it's best to con...more

Dove sulphate and parabens free shampoo is generally considered safe for use. While it does contain sulfate and fragrance, it is formulated to be gentle on the scalp and hair. Sulfates are commonly used in shampoos to create lather, but they can be harsh on the hair and scalp, causing dryness and irritation. The sulfates in dove shampoo are milder than those found in other shampoos, and the product also contains moisturizing ingredients to help prevent dryness.
Fragrance is also included in ...more
